D&D London to launch Royal Exchange outdoor café

Published:  17 December, 2010

D&D London is to launch new outdoor café at the Royal Exchange, London to open in summer 2011.

The company has more than 30 top restaurants in central London, Paris, Copenhagen, New York and Tokyo and will add the outdoor space to its grade 1 listed Royal Exchange Grand Café.

It announced today that it has agreed terms with property owners Fenlay Limited to develop the space which will serve around 100 covers and will also offer food to take away.

It will be designed by Conran & Partners, the interior designers of D&D's existing ventures at the Royal Exchange (Restaurant Sauterelle and Royal Exchange Grand Café).


Des Gunewardena, chairman & chief executive officer of D&D London, said:



"A snowy December may seem a strange time to be thinking about pavement cafes. But we are very excited about this project. We are planning to create something different but complimentary to the Royal Exchange Grand Café, which has been a big success for us."
